Model Robyn Lawley is styled by Jana Pokorny in sun-drenched images by Simon Upton for Marie Claire Australia’s sustainability issue.

Looking out across the Whitsunday’s iconic turquoise water after a day of shooting on an isolated beach off Hamilton Island, Robyn Lawley is confused. “The ocean is so beautiful and fragile. I don’t understand why everyone’s not fighting for it,” she says, shaking her head. “Our seas produce half of the world’s oxygen, yet we’re dumping a garbage truck of rubbish into [them] every minute.”

As a young girl, Lawley was protesting fossil fuels in Queensland, writing “stop coal mining” on her bare stomach in lipstick before spreading the message on social media. Lawley lives with partner Everest Schmidt in New York today, where they’re raising her daughter Ripley — now four years old — to be an environmentalist.

Speaking of Victoria’s Secret and taking on former chief marketing officer Ed Razek for his troubling comments abut transgender and plus-size models, prompting Lawley to launch the “we are all angels hashtag”, she says the fight was intimidating given the status of Victoria’s Secret. Still, Robyn is glad that Razek is gone and the brand is in a period of active self-reflection under new leadership.

Asked in her interview with Alley Pascoe if there’s anything Victoria’s Secret can do to redeem themselves, the activist’s response resonates Rihanna-style:

“In my dream world, they (Victoria’s Secret) would send recyclable, compostable lingerie down the runway, [worn by] models with variance in size, ethnicities and age,” says Lawley, curling the corner of her mega-watt smile at the thought.
